Ingredients:
1 cup (240 ml) whole milk
2 tablespoons butter
1 cup (200 g) granulated sugar
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ract (optional)
Instructions:
In a medium saucepan, mix the milk and sugar.
Place over medium heat and stir constantly until the sugar is fully dissolved.
Bring the mixture to a gentle simmer, reduce the heat to low, and let it cook for about 30-40 minutes, stirring occasionally.
As it cooks, the milk will reduce and thicken to a creamy consistency.
Remove from heat, add butter, and stir until melted and smooth.
For extra flavor, you can add vanilla extract at the end.
Let it cool before pouring into jars. Store it in the refrigerator, and it should last up to two weeks. Enjoy your homemade condensed milk for desserts, drinks, or as a sweet treat on its own!
